Power dynamics, life strategies, and owning your life.Steven Pinker never defends or justify violence of course, however he does explain that it’s a natural part being a human.The most violent stage of life is toddlerhood, and though most humans rein it back as they age, we still continue having violent thoughts.However, we also have natural inborn mechanisms to keep that violence in check, says Steven Pinker.Since violence is dangerous for each single individual of a species and can also be counterproductive for the group, humans evolved dominance hierarchies.Steven Pinker says that dominance hierarchies are based on who The male at the top has access to more women and resources, which means that as hierarchies reduce violence, they also encourage it to reach the top position.In men it’s not as crude as it is in other animals, but remnants can still be seen today.The author says that as humans developed into hunter gatherer societies women became more interested in commitment from men than simple sperm from the most dominant.Indeed, since raising children costed lots of efforts and resources, women also wanted loyal men who would provide help. Also read: The inventor of the printing press gave us a tool that allowed for humanitarian philosophy to spread, As this philosophy started seeping into the design of states and governments between the 16th and 18th century, it reduced superstitious and religious killings, like those from the above mentioned witch-hunts and crusades or other religious wars.Humanism also condemned slavery, which was over time abolished by all countries, the Europe and US being mostly slavery-free by the end of the 19th century.Lastly, in a humanitarian world even criminals are treated with dignity, mostly eradicating violence from the world of crime, law and order too.As you can see, despite the drama in the news, the world isn’t as bad a place as you might think.

The Better Angels of Our Nature: Why Violence Has Declined is a 2011 book by Steven Pinker, in which the author argues that violence in the world has declined both in the long run and in the short run and suggests explanations as to why this has occurred.
